Trial Purpose:
Evaluation of Oakite Inproclean 3800
Date Run:
05/11/1995Experiment Procedure:
Coupons were cleaned and dried with a heat gun to get the clean weight. A total of nine coupons were contaminated with contaminants #1, #2 and #4. #3 was omitted because of lack of coupons and this appears to be the easiest contaminant to remove. The coupons were then weighed after contamination. Cleaning was done in an agitated stirbar beaker at 140 degrees for 5 minutes. The parts were then rinsed in tap water at 140 degrees for 5 minutes. Drying was done under the air knives for 2 minutes and then placed in an oven set at 216 degrees for 90 minutes.
Trial Results:
Lapping compound cleaned at 142 degrees, some removal by aggitation alone, very easy to remove contaminant by brushing for about 15 seconds. Vavoline grease cleaned at 146 degrees. Residual lapping compound in the cleaner seems to be clinging to the grease at first, but after a few minutes, you can see the grease being removed. Excellent removal of grease upon cleaning and rinsing. The Oakite cleaner is doing an excellent job of removing the Selmer oil. It appears one of the coupons was quite dirty after cleaning (the other two looked clean), this is probably due to the lack of aggitation it recieved.
TURI SURFACE CLEANING LAB EXPERIMENTAL DATA LOG
GRAVIMENTRIC ANALYSIS
sample # and contaminant | clean weight (g) | weight with contamination (g) | weight after cleaning (g) | weight change (g) | % Removal |
5881, cont. #1 | 34.5897 | 34.9895 | 34.5895 | 0.40 | 100 |
4080, cont. #1 | 34.4089 | 34.6598 | 34.4089 | 0.2509 | 100 |
4401, cont. #1 | 34.4408 | 34.7038 | 34.4408 | 0.263 | 100 |
4317, cont. #2 | 34.4315 | 34.5241 | 34.4324 | 0.0917 | 99 |
4470, cont. #2 | 34.4474 | 34.5255 | 34.448 | 0.0775 | 99.2 |
7399, cont. #2 | 34.7364 | 34.8441 | 34.7406 | 0.1035 | 96.1 |
5330, cont. #4 | 34.5332 | 34.6049 | 34.5352 | 0.0697 | 97.2 |
4801, cont. #4 | 34.4806 | 34.5507 | 34.5149 | 0.0358 | 51.1 |
1803, cont. #4 | 34.1814 | 34.2687 | 34.1827 | 0.086 | 98.5 |
Cont. #1- Clover Grease Mix Lapping Compound
Cont. #2- Valvoline Wheel Bearing Grease
Cont. #3- 90 Wt Gear Oil
Cont. #4- Selmer Tuning Slide and Cork Grease
Success Rating:
Results successful using TACT (time, agitation, concentration, and temperature, as well as rinsing and drying) and/or other cleaning chemistries examined.Conclusion:
The Oakite 3800 was the best cleaner overall with a percentage removal of contaminants ranging from 100 to 51 percent. The 51 percent achieved on coupon 4801 was due to the lack of agitation this part received.
Due to the success of this trial, Oakite 3800 will be used on the next trial for Musical Instrument Re-finisher when the parts from Musical Instrument Re-finisher will be cleaned with beaker agitation. This time contaminant #3 will be used and we are considering cleaning off the pieces with a cloth instead of a brush to protect the surface.
